Painting Description
"Faneuses" is a notable painting by the French artist Camille Pissarro, created in 1891. Pissarro, a key figure in the Impressionist movement, is renowned for his depictions of rural life and landscapes, and "Faneuses" exemplifies his commitment to capturing the essence of agrarian labor. The title "Faneuses" translates to "Haymakers" in English, and the painting portrays women engaged in the traditional task of haymaking, a common rural activity during the late 19th century.
The composition of "Faneuses" is characterized by its harmonious blend of color and light, typical of Pissarro's mature style. The artist employs a palette of earthy tones and soft greens to depict the pastoral scene, while the figures of the women are rendered with a sense of movement and vitality. Pissarro's brushwork is both delicate and dynamic, capturing the texture of the hay and the play of sunlight across the landscape.
Pissarro's interest in the lives of rural workers is evident in this piece, reflecting his broader social and political concerns. As an advocate of anarchist principles, Pissarro often sought to highlight the dignity and resilience of the working class through his art. "Faneuses" is a testament to this ethos, presenting the haymakers with a sense of respect and admiration.
The painting also demonstrates Pissarro's innovative approach to perspective and composition. By positioning the figures within a vast, open landscape, he creates a sense of depth and space that draws the viewer into the scene. The use of light and shadow further enhances the three-dimensional quality of the work, making it a compelling example of Pissarro's skill as a landscape painter.
"Faneuses" is housed in the Musée d'Orsay in Paris, where it continues to be celebrated as a significant work within Pissarro's oeuvre and the broader context of Impressionist art. The painting not only showcases Pissarro's technical prowess but also his deep empathy for the subjects he depicted, making it a poignant and enduring piece of art history.
